cdn网页架构_内容分发网络 CDN

CDN是一种将网站内容分发到全球各地服务器的技术,以提高访问速度和稳定性。
cdn网页架构_内容分发网络 CDN

【CDN网页架构_内容分发网络】

内容分发网络(Content Delivery Network,CDN)是一种用于加速网站内容传输的网络架构,它通过将网站的静态和动态内容缓存到全球各地的服务器上,使用户可以从离他们最近的服务器获取所需的内容,从而减少延迟和提高加载速度,下面将详细介绍CDN的工作原理、优势以及如何配置和使用CDN。

CDN的工作原理

1、缓存机制:CDN通过在全球范围内部署多个节点服务器,将网站的静态和动态内容缓存到这些服务器上,当用户请求一个资源时,CDN会首先检查本地缓存中是否有该资源,如果有,则直接返回给用户;如果没有,则从源服务器获取资源并缓存到本地,然后返回给用户。

2、智能路由:CDN会根据用户的地理位置和网络状况,选择最佳的节点服务器来提供服务,这样可以确保用户能够从离他们最近的服务器获取所需的内容,从而减少延迟和提高加载速度。

3、负载均衡:CDN通过负载均衡技术,将用户的请求分发到不同的节点服务器上,以实现资源的高可用性和高并发处理能力,当某个节点服务器出现故障或过载时,CDN会自动将请求转发到其他正常的节点服务器上,保证服务的连续性。

CDN的优势

cdn网页架构_内容分发网络 CDN

1、提高加载速度:CDN通过将内容缓存到全球各地的服务器上,使用户可以从离他们最近的服务器获取所需的内容,从而减少延迟和提高加载速度,这对于提高用户体验和增加网站流量非常重要。

2、减轻源服务器压力:CDN通过将用户的请求分发到不同的节点服务器上,可以有效地减轻源服务器的压力,提高源服务器的处理能力和稳定性。

3、提高安全性:CDN通过使用SSL证书和HTTPS协议,可以对用户的数据进行加密传输,保护用户的数据安全。

4、支持大流量:CDN通过负载均衡和智能路由技术,可以实现对大流量的支持和处理,保证服务的稳定和可靠性。

如何配置和使用CDN

1、选择合适的CDN服务提供商:市场上有许多CDN服务提供商,如阿里云、腾讯云、亚马逊AWS等,在选择CDN服务提供商时,需要考虑其覆盖范围、服务质量、价格等因素。

cdn网页架构_内容分发网络 CDN

2、配置CDN域名:在CDN服务提供商的控制台中,需要将网站的域名解析到CDN提供的CNAME记录上,这样,当用户访问网站时,DNS服务器会将请求转发到CDN的节点服务器上。

3、配置CDN缓存规则:根据网站的需求,可以配置CDN的缓存规则,包括缓存时间、缓存的内容类型等,这样可以确保用户始终能够获取到最新的内容。

4、监控和优化CDN性能:通过CDN服务提供商提供的监控工具,可以实时监控CDN的性能指标,如响应时间、命中率等,根据监控结果,可以对CDN进行优化和调整,以提高服务的性能和稳定性。

与本文相关的问题及解答

问题1:CDN适用于哪些类型的网站?

答:CDN适用于各种类型的网站,特别是那些静态内容较多、需要快速加载的网站,电商网站、新闻网站、博客网站等都可以使用CDN来提高用户体验和增加网站流量。

问题2:使用CDN会增加成本吗?

答:使用CDN会增加一定的成本,但相对于提高用户体验和增加网站流量所带来的收益来说,这些成本是值得的,不同的CDN服务提供商提供的价格和服务也有所不同,可以根据自己的需求选择合适的CDN服务提供商。

内容分发网络(CDN)是一种用于加速网站内容传输的网络架构,它通过将网站的静态和动态内容缓存到全球各地的服务器上,使用户可以从离他们最近的服务器获取所需的内容,从而减少延迟和提高加载速度,CDN具有提高加载速度、减轻源服务器压力、提高安全性和支持大流量等优势,要配置和使用CDN,需要选择合适的CDN服务提供商、配置CDN域名、配置CDN缓存规则以及监控和优化CDN性能,虽然使用CDN会增加一定的成本,但相对于提高用户体验和增加网站流量所带来的收益来说,这些成本是值得的。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/528626.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-06-07 23:47
Next 2024-06-07 23:50

相关推荐

  • 韩国服务器速度慢的原因有哪些

    韩国服务器速度慢的原因可能包括网络拥堵、服务器配置低、地理位置较远等。

    2024-05-10
    0172
  • web服务器配置与管理的技巧有哪些方面

    答:优化Web服务器配置参数需要根据实际情况进行调整,可以调整PHP-FPM、Node.js等模块的内存限制、连接数限制;调整MySQL等数据库的缓存大小、连接数;调整Nginx的worker_processes、worker_connections等参数,在调整参数时,要注意观察服务器的运行状况,适时调整,3、如何保证Web服务器的安全性?答:保证Web服务器的安全性需要从多个方面入手,要启

    2023-12-09
    0142
  • 负载均衡带宽问题怎么解决的

    负载均衡带宽问题怎么解决在现代互联网应用中,负载均衡是一种常见的技术手段,用于将请求分发到多个服务器上,以提高系统的可用性和性能,随着用户量的增加和业务的发展,负载均衡系统可能会面临带宽瓶颈的问题,本文将介绍如何解决负载均衡带宽问题,并提供一些实用的技术教程。一、了解带宽瓶颈的原因我们需要了解导致负载均衡带宽瓶颈的原因,常见的原因包括……

    2023-11-13
    0179
  • 什么是服务器虚拟节点?它在现代计算中扮演了什么角色?

    虚拟节点是一种计算机网络技术,主要用于负载均衡和数据分布,它是一种逻辑概念,在物理节点的基础上通过映射算法将一或多个物理节点映射为一个或多个虚拟节点,从而提高数据的负载均衡和可用性,假设有三个物理节点A、B、C,它们的哈希值分别为10、20、30,通过虚拟节点技术,我们可以将这三个物理节点映射为三个虚拟节点,虚……

    2024-12-15
    01
  • cdn云分发_内容分发网络 CDN

    CDN是一种通过互联网互相连接的计算机网络系统,其目的是将内容更接近用户,以提高访问速度和质量。

    2024-06-17
    0120
  • 服务器优化:提高吞吐量,给主机加油(服务器的吞吐量一般为多少)

    服务器优化可以提高吞吐量,但具体数值因服务器配置和负载而异。服务器的吞吐量可以达到几百到几千个请求/秒。

    行业资讯 2024-04-20
    0117

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入